Cucumber Jalapeño Margarita
This cucumber jalapeño margarita recipe is so refreshing! Nothing tastes better than the combination of tequila and jalapeño — the cucumber just adds a freshness and helps to balance the heat. The longer it chills, the more jalapeño and cucumber infuse into the tequila. Serve over ice in a salt-rimmed glass, garnished with cucumber slices.
